Case Studies of Successful Regional Financial Cooperation Strategies
Several regional financial institutions have successfully implemented strategies that showcase effective cooperation. One notable example is the Latin American Reserve Fund (FLAR), which facilitates currency swap agreements among member countries. These arrangements provide member nations with liquidity support during financial crises, strengthening regional economic stability and cooperation.
Another exemplary case is the Organisation of Eastern Caribbean States (OECS) Currency Union. By establishing a common currency, the Eastern Caribbean dollar, the member states have substantially reduced transaction costs and enhanced cross-border trade. This strategy demonstrates how monetary integration can promote regional financial stability and economic growth.
The Southern African Development Community (SADC) implemented a regional payment system to facilitate seamless transactions across member states. This infrastructure has improved financial connectivity, reduced transaction times, and lowered costs, exemplifying how infrastructure projects can drive successful regional cooperation strategies.
These case studies highlight the importance of combining policy frameworks, infrastructure development, and institutional collaboration. They offer insights into practical approaches that regional financial institutions can adopt to enhance cooperation and foster sustainable economic integration.
